Key Survey Results: Employee Perks

In the OperationsInc Flash Survey “Employee Perks”, we discover the “fringe” benefits companies offer, broken down by company size and benefit provided.

“FRINGE” BENEFIT OFFERINGS

Key Finding:

  • Over 56% of participating companies provide snacks and drinks to their employees.
  • Close to half of respondents provide tuition reimbursement benefits.
  • 40% of respondents provide transit benefits – this benefit is required for companies in NYC who have over 20 employees.
  • Only 8.8% of participating companies indicated that they don’t provide any fringe benefits.


“FRINGE” BENEFIT VALUE TO EMPLOYEES

Key Finding:

  • Company provided snacks and drinks were by far the overall most valuable “fringe” benefit as reported by survey participants.
  • Tuition reimbursement and paid or subsidized meals were also seen as being highly valued by employees.
  • Rounding out the top 5 most valued benefits are transit benefits and on-site gyms.

 

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ION

  • Survey Time Period: May 2017
  • Number of Participating Companies: 80
  • Regional Concentration: Fairfield County, CT / New York Metro area
